The federal government of Nigeria has authorized Dangote Refinery to become the exclusive supplier of jet fuel (Jet A1) to airline operators in Nigeria. Minister of Aviation, Festus Keyamo, announced the development during an interview on Channels TV on Tuesday, October 8, 2024.

Keyamo explained that the decision had the support of Nigerian airline operators:

“The airline operators just met recently. With my blessing, it’s a decision from the airline operators in Nigeria that they should only buy from Dangote refinery Jet A1.”

He further clarified that the new arrangement aligns with the naira-for-crude deal recently initiated between Dangote and the federal government:

“It’s all Naira, no Dollar component… We will buy in naira. I’m sure we are going to have access to cheaper Jet A1 fuel.”

This move aims to stabilize prices and reduce reliance on foreign exchange markets.
